Tug & Barge Tours

Several times a year, we leave our Red Hook, Brooklyn homeport to take the show on the road. The Waterfront Museum's 1914 Barge #79 has no motor, but with the help of a tugboat, we can bring our free and low-cost programs to ports as close as Manhattan or as far away as Waterford above Albany.  

Teaming up with the 1907 Tug Pegasus, in 2010, we traveled to the new Brooklyn Bridge Park and Manhattan's Hudson River Park where we had a non-stop program of activities, including a Sea Chanty concert, free boat tours, deep sea diver Lenny under the boat, and much more. To find out about upcoming trips or reserve your spot for an unforgettable voyage, email dsharps@waterfrontmuseum.org.
